Prefetcher notes for new maintainers of Cartfall. The service warms map tiles along predicted routes, pulling from the Ombren tile store. Tune batch size in prefetch.toml; default 64. Eviction is LRU, capped at 2 GB per node. Deploys go through the Strayline pipeline; staging first, always. Rollbacks take one command: strayline revert. Production pushes require the deploy key shown below.

signing key of fajop-tahop = bky9_qdL6xeDv7

### Runbook: Sproutline scheduler release checks

Before each Sproutline release, verify the watering scheduler's timezone table matches the greenhouse controller firmware, and run the dry-cycle simulation against the staging plots. A mismatch causes double-watering at midnight rollover. Releases are blocked until the simulation report is green. The release gate criteria and simulation instructions are maintained on the internal page below.

dashboard of yahaf-kajep = https://jira.zemvarsys.internal/display/projects/browse/browse/a08b

## Cold Starts — Approval Policy

Serverless handlers on Quillfall spin down after 12 minutes idle. First request after spin-down can take 4–8 seconds. Do not escalate cold-start latency as an incident. Any change to warm-pool sizing or keep-alive pings requires written approval before deploy. Support may request a review, but cannot self-approve. Approval authority rests with one person.

account owner for bawip-tahag: Raleth Quenok

## Step 3: Register with the graph host

Graphlace plugins run inside the visualizer's worker pool. Build with `graphlace-cli build`, then register the bundle so the host can resolve your node renderers. Registration reads from `.env` in the bundle root. Required keys: `GRAPHLACE_PLUGIN_ID`, `GRAPHLACE_ENTRY`, and `GRAPHLACE_SCOPE` (set to `edges` or `nodes`, not both). Misconfigured scope fails silently — check the worker log. Registration calls are authenticated; append your plugin's registration secret on the line below these keys.

sealed setting: RELAY_SECRET5=82864